ScreenTinker f289609380 fix(auth): back break-glass recovery with a revocable, auditable grant
scripts/reset-admin.js mints a JWT carrying `recovery: true`, and middleware/auth.js
accepted that claim on its own with no database involvement. Three consequences:

- NOT REVOCABLE. The only way to invalidate an outstanding recovery token was to rotate
  JWT_SECRET, which logs out every user on the instance.
- NOT ENUMERABLE. Nobody could answer "is a recovery token outstanding right now?"
- NOT AUDITED. The synthetic id ('recovery-<nonce>') is not a users row, so every
  activity_log insert for it failed the user_id foreign key and was swallowed by a catch —
  a break-glass session left no trace at all.

A `recovery_grants` row per minted token turns all three around: DELETE revokes, SELECT
enumerates, expires_at bounds, and used_at + source_ip record when and from where it was
first exercised. The migration is additive and idempotent, so re-running is a no-op and a
code-only rollback just leaves an unused table.

The grant is session-scoped, NOT single-use-per-request. Recovery means many requests —
load the dashboard, list users, reset a password — so consuming the grant on the first
would make break-glass unusable, a worse outcome than the narrow replay window it closes.
Revocation and expiry are the controls; used_at is the audit stamp.

Also fixed, because it is the mechanism that hid this: logActivity now rewrites a
'recovery-*' id to a NULL user_id with the identity in `details`, so break-glass actions
are actually recorded instead of failing the FK; and a dropped audit row now logs a loud
[AUDIT-DROP] line naming the action and increments a counter, rather than vanishing into
console.error.

The token is written to a 0600 file instead of stdout — under systemd or Docker, printing
it meant journald captured a live admin credential well past its lifetime. Added --list
and --revoke-all.

In-flight recovery tokens minted before this change stop working; they live one hour and
were unrevocable, which is the problem being fixed. Minting already required a working DB,
so redeeming against one is not a new dependency.

test/session-token-resolution.test.js now mints a real grant for its recovery token, so
its assertions keep testing that break-glass is refused on those surfaces for lack of a
users row — not for the unrelated new reason that the token is invalid.
